PSAT 8/9 is a standardized standardized test administered to eighth and ninth-grade students. It serves as an early indication of college readiness and provides practice for future SAT exams. The test measures skills in reading, writing, and math, aiming to prepare students for higher-level assessments and academic success in high school and beyond.
Key Features
- Designed for students in grades 8 and 9
- Measures critical reading, math, and writing skills
- Serves as a preparatory step for the SAT
- Offers insights into student academic strengths and weaknesses
- Includes multiple-choice questions similar to those on the SAT
Pros
- Provides early exposure to standardized testing formats
- Helps identify areas for academic improvement
- Encourages college readiness awareness at an earlier stage
- Predictive of future SAT performance
Cons
- Limited recognition compared to college admissions tests
- May cause unnecessary stress for some students or parents
- Some critics argue it may not fully reflect a student's potential
- Cost may be a barrier for some families
